Presentation of tram line 16E

Lisszabon

The proposed tram line 16E is set to establish a connection between the city center and the eastern region of Lisbon (Oriente), thereby enhancing transportation services across six areas: Santa Maria Maior, São Vicente, Penha de França, Beato, Marvila, and Parque das Nações. Notably, this will be the first tram line in Lisbon to operate entirely on a dedicated track, equipped with priority traffic signals along its route to ensure optimal travel times and adherence to the established schedule.

This tram line is part of the broader eastern segment of the Lisbon high-speed tram project, which has undergone extensive study for over three decades. The line will extend the existing riverside railway from Algés, traversing Praça do Comércio (as tram line 15E) to Parque das Nações (designated as 16E). It is expected to significantly reduce the travel time from the city center to Parque das Nações, decreasing it from the current approximate duration of 60 minutes to a mere 35 minutes.

Tram line 16E is anticipated to provide a reliable and frequent service, contributing to the positioning of Lisbon as a more sustainable urban environment, with enhanced mobility and expedited connections. With a planned investment of €160,000,000, which includes the acquisition of new articulated trams, this initiative is expected to serve as a viable alternative to automobile transportation.

Demand studies project that this new line will accommodate approximately 7.6 to 8.1 million passengers annually, with an estimated 16 to 18% of those comprising new users of public transport.

Projected stops along the route of 16E:
  • Terreiro do Paço
  • Terminal de Cruzeiros
  • Santa Apolónia
  • Mouzinho de Albuquerque
  • Xabregas
  • Fábrica de Unicórnios
  • Marvila
  • Poço do Bispo
  • Braço de Prata
  • Matinha
  • Pq. Nações Sul
  • Oceanário
  • Estação Oriente
  • Torre Vasco Gama
  • Alameda Oceanos Norte
  • Rotunda da Colômbia
  • Parque Tejo
  • Parque Nações Norte
The line is supposed to be completed and start operating in 2027/2028. It is somewhat ironic that at the onset of the 1990s, Lisbon opted to close and dismantle a regular tram line that connected Terreiro do Paço to Poço do Bispo. This historical tram line operated almost parallel to the 16E, albeit positioned a few hundred meters further into the city. The segment of the old tram line would have encompassed approximately half of the total length of the 16E line.
